Employee Retention: It Isn't About the Money The old saying "You get what you pay for" holds true when it comes to your employees too, but many employers miss a big opportunity because they think only in terms of dollars when, in their employees' minds, "compensation" is about much more than money. HR surveys repeatedly show that people who love their jobs would not leave for a 10 percent pay hike. Only about four percent would consider an offer of 15 percent or more, and the other 96% wouldn't consider it at all unless the offer was at least 20-25 percent more. So, if it isn't about the money, what is it your people want from you? What are the intangibles that keep great people on-board and motivated? Achievement-Based Interviewing/Evidence-Based Selection Every company has a hiring system, and every system delivers 100% of what it's designed to give. Unfortunately, most hiring systems don't work, as evidenced by reports from the U.S. Department of Labor that 50% of all new frontline, hourly employees quit or are fired within their first six months on the job. It's a result of most companies that have not developed a standardized recruiting and selection hiring system. And because many of the organizations that DO have systems use outmoded behavioral interviewing techniques. Behavioral interviewing itself isn't a bad technique. Yet myriad books, articles and computer programs have taught job seekers how to give the answers interviewers want to hear. Current hiring research shows that most job applicants know what questions will be asked--and how to answer them. The result: too many companies hire great applicants instead of great employees. The solution lies in switching to a hiring system built on achievement-based interviewing and evidence-based selection.
